Hampden Park, Glasgow, Scotland - May 10, 1947
British return to FIFA
Great Britain 6  
(Mannion 22, pen., 33, Steel, 35, Lawton, 37, 82, Own Goal (Parola-Da Rui), 74)
Europe 1  
(Nordahl 24)
HT: 4-1.
Att: 137,000
Ref: Reader (Eng).

Frank Swift, George Hardwick, captain, Stanley Matthews and Tommy Lawton played for Great Britain in the match celebrating the readmission of England, Scotland and Wales to FIFA.

Great Britain:  Swift, England; Hardwick, England, captain; Hughes, Wales; Macaulay, Scotland; Vernon, Northern Ireland; Burgess, Wales; Matthews, England; Mannion, England; Lawton, England; Steel, Scotland; Liddell, Scotland.  Selector:  Walter Winterbottom, England.

Rest of Europe:  Da Rui, France; Peterson, Denmark; Steffen, Switzerland; Carey, Eire; Parola, Italy; Ludl, Czechoslovakia; Lembrechts, Belgium; Gren, Sweden; Nordahl, Sweden; Wilkes, Holland; Praest, Denmark.  Selector:  Rappan, Austria.
